  167. For generations of immigrants, socialism offered more than a program; it offered a home. In the fraternal societies, the workers’ choruses, and the summer camps like Camp Kinderland, people found a community that valued their dignity and intellect when the broader society treated them as a laboring mass. The movement provided a narrative that made sense of their suffering—it was not a personal failing but a systemic condition—and a promise that their children might inherit a better city. This sense of embeddedness was a form of psychic armor against the disorienting pressures of assimilation and exploitation, a way to maintain one’s humanity in a dehumanizing system. The socialist hall became a sanctuary where one was a citizen of a future world in the making. http://mamdanipost.com

  174. The neoliberal turn from the 1970s onward radically altered the calculus of reform. As the city and federal government actively dismantled the social wage, privatized public goods, and unleashed financial capital, defending past reforms became a radical act. The fight to preserve public housing, to stop hospital closures, or to defend rent stabilization was no longer a step toward something greater, but a desperate, rearguard action against a voracious counter-revolution. In this context, reformism could feel like a holding action, while the revolutionary horizon seemed to recede. This period fostered a defensive militancy that was often strong on resistance but weaker at articulating a compelling, transformative vision for the city’s future. http://mamdanipost.com

  248. This persistence is also geographic and demographic. While the specific ethnic compositions of the left have changed—from German and Jewish immigrants to Puerto Rican and Black activists to a new, multi-racial millennial and Gen Z base—the neighborhoods themselves often remain theaters of struggle. The Lower East Side, Harlem, the South Bronx: these places have hosted successive waves of radical activity, their very streets holding a kind of accumulated radical energy. New organizers move into apartments where old ones once lived, often unknowingly continuing a conversation that spans a century. http://mamdanipost.com
